Sailing the Greek islandsYour crew and hosts for your sailing holiday in Greece, Kostas and Lynda, met several years ago during a Greek-Islands flotilla organized by CruisingWorld magazine, where Lynda was managing editor. Their shared passions for sailing, exploring, and cooking tied them together. Now they are married, own and operate an Atlantic 70, Stressbuster, and sail as a team; captain and crew/cook. Be their guests and let them show you the Greek Islands from the perspective of both a native Greek and an American who fell in love with the country (and a Greek!). Let them also share with you their home-style preparations of delicious Greek and Mediterranean cuisine.
